Joyce Kilmer Rest Stop Ranked Tenth Busiest in Northeast
Foursquare check-ins during last year's Thanksgiving travel season were used to create a list of the most-trafficked rest stops in the country.

Pull over: the Joyce Kilmer Service Area in East Brunswick ranked as the tenth busiest rest stop in the entire northeast for Thanksgiving week, according to USA Today.

According to the report, the list was compiled by counting the volume of Foursquare check-ins at rest stops throughout the country between Nov. 20-25 2012.
In addition to Joyce Kilmer, three other NJ Turnpike rest stops were featured on the list of busiest stops in the northeast: the Thomas Edison Service Area in Woodbridge, the Molly Pitcher Service Area in Cranbury, and the Vince Lombardi Service Area in Ridgefield.
The busiest rest stop in the entire northeast is the Delaware Welcome Travel Plaza, according to the list.
